# Rspamd normal worker |
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
Rspamd normal worker is intended to scan messages for spam. It has the following configuration options available: |
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
* `mime`: turn to `off` if you want to scan non-mime messages (e.g. forum comments or SMS), default: `on` |
|
|
|
* `allow_learn`: turn to `on` if you want to learn messages using this worker (usually you should use [controller](controller.md) worker), default: `off` |
|
|
|
* `timeout`: input/output timeout, default: `1min` |
|
|
|
* `task_timeout`: maximum time to process a single task, default: `8s` |
|
|
|
* `max_tasks`: maximum count of tasks processes simultaneously, default: `0` - no limit |
|
|
|
* `keypair`: encryption keypair |

## Encryption support |
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
To generate a keypair for the scanner you could use: |
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
rspamadm keypair -u |
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
After that keypair should appear as following: |
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
~~~nginx |
|
|
|
keypair { |
|
|
|
pubkey = "tm8zjw3ougwj1qjpyweugqhuyg4576ctg6p7mbrhma6ytjewp4ry"; |
|
|
|
privkey = "ykkrfqbyk34i1ewdmn81ttcco1eaxoqgih38duib1e7b89h9xn3y"; |
|
|
|
} |
|
|
|
~~~ |
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
You can use its **public** part thereafter when scanning messages as following: |
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
rspamc --key tm8zjw3ougwj1qjpyweugqhuyg4576ctg6p7mbrhma6ytjewp4ry <file> |
